Ramaphosa prepares major reorganisation of mining and energy portfolios

Minister of Electricity Kgosientsho Ramokgopa, and Minister of Energy Gwede Mantashe, at the South African Parliament in May 2023.
Minister of Electricity Kgosientsho Ramokgopa, and Minister of Energy Gwede Mantashe, at the South African Parliament in May 2023. © Esa Alexander / Reuters
South Africa's head of state plans to reform his ministries after the 2024 presidential election, cutting down on work duplication and improving efficiency in the face of the energy crisis by creating separate ministries for mining and energy and abolishing the portfolio of state-owned companies.
